Setting the Stage at Tiburón Golf Club

The Tiburón Golf Club, known for its two challenging 18-hole courses designed by Greg Norman, hosts the CME Group Tour Championship annually. The Gold and Black courses demand precision and strategic play, making it a fitting venue for the LPGA season finale.
